Job Purpose

The Fraud Senior Analyst plays a critical role in protecting the organization’s International Health portfolio by leading Fraud, Waste and Abuse (FWA) investigations, driving measurable affordability outcomes, and strengthening prevention strategies across the claims lifecycle. The position combines investigative expertise, data-driven insight, and stakeholder influence to reduce financial leakage, improve claim governance and support sustainable savings delivery across the region. This role is responsible for detecting and recovering FWA payments, creating solutions to prevent claims overpayment and future spend monitoring within a dedicated region. He / She will work closely with other PI team members, Network, Medical Economics, Data Analytics, Claims Operations, Clinical partners, and Product.

Job Profile

Operating with a high degree of independence, the Fraud Senior Analyst owns end-to-end investigative activities within a dedicated region. The role extends beyond case handling to include proactive identification of systemic risks, development of preventive controls, and partnership with regional and global stakeholders to enhance Payment Integrity strategy. The incumbent acts as a subject matter expert, contributing to operational improvements, automation initiatives, and cross-market collaboration to strengthen FWA detection and mitigation capabilities.

Critical Tasks and Expected Contributions / Results:

  • Lead FWA investigations across International Markets, applying investigative judgement to identify billing anomalies, emerging fraud typologies, and systemic risk patterns.

  • Deliver quantifiable financial impact through cost containment, recoveries, and forward-looking prevention initiatives aligned to regional savings objectives.

  • Translate data insights into actionable investigation strategies by partnering closely with Data and Analytics teams to refine triggers, reporting frameworks and automation opportunities.

  • Influence provider behavior through structured Provider audit engagement, negotiation, and collaboration with regional and global stakeholders to reduce future risk exposure.

  • Drive continuous improvement of Payment Integrity processes by identifying operational gaps and proposing scalable solutions that enhance efficiency and accuracy.

  • Produce clear, defensible investigative findings and recommendations for senior stakeholders, ensuring transparency and audit readiness.

  • Ensure investigations and cost containment actions are balanced with fair member outcomes, regulatory expectations, and client commitments.

  • Collaborate with Customer Service and Client Management teams to support clear, consistent communication approaches that protect member experience while maintaining investigative integrity

  • Operate within established governance frameworks, ensuring investigative activities are compliant with internal policies, regulatory requirements, and audit standards.

  • Collaborate with the Member Investigation Unit on Fraud cases when required.

  • Perform periodic TPA oversight and partner with TPAs on FWA investigations when required.

  • Partner with Data Analytics team in building future FWA triggers automation.

  • Mentor and provide support  through knowledge sharing, quality review input and guidance on investigative best practices and share FWA claiming schemes.

  • Ad hoc duties as assigned

Key Challenges / Anticipated Changes in Environment:

  • Rapid evolution of provider billing models and fraud schemes requiring adaptive investigative approaches.

  • Increasing claim volumes and evolving FWA typologies requiring advanced analytical and investigative skills

  • Balancing operational turnaround times with deep investigative rigor, stakeholder expectations and member experience considerations

  • Expanding use of automation, data analytics, and cross-market collaboration within Payment Integrity operations

  • Managing complex provider relationships while maintaining firm compliance and cost containment positions

  • Navigating diverse regulatory and healthcare environments across multiple international markets
